Botox in Dubai UAE also known as Botulinum Toxin Type A, has gained immense popularity not just for its cosmetic benefits but also for its wide range of therapeutic applications. While many associate Botox with wrinkle-smoothing treatments, its medical uses extend far beyond aesthetics, offering profound relief for various conditions. Here are some lesser-known yet impactful medical uses of Botox available in Dubai:

1. Chronic Migraines: Botox serves as a preventive therapy for chronic migraines by blocking pain pathways, reducing frequency, duration, and severity of headaches. Precise injections in areas around the head, neck, and shoulders can provide significant relief for patients.

2. Severe Underarm Sweating (Hyperhidrosis): Botox injections can effectively reduce excessive sweating in the underarms, palms, and feet, offering relief and boosting confidence for individuals struggling with this condition.

3. Muscle Spasticity and Dystonia: Botox is used to treat neurological disorders like Cervical Dystonia, Blepharospasm, Hemifacial Spasm, and spasticity associated with conditions like stroke, cerebral palsy, or Multiple Sclerosis, improving pain, muscle function, and mobility.

4. Overactive Bladder (OAB) and Urinary Incontinence: Botox injections into the bladder muscle help relax it, reducing urgency and frequency of urination, providing significant relief for individuals with severe bladder issues.

5. TMJ Disorders and Bruxism: Botox injections into jaw muscles can alleviate jaw pain, headaches, and protect dental health for individuals with chronic jaw clenching or TMJ disorders.

6. Strabismus ("Lazy Eye"): Botox injections in eye muscles can help correct misaligned eyes, avoiding the need for more invasive surgical procedures.
